Easy & Fluffy Tofu Naan
- 1 block Tofu (350 g)
- 2 tbsp Olive oil
- 1 tbsp Baking powder
- 1 Cake flour (or bread or all-purpose flour), 90% of the weight of tofu
- Mash the tofu and microwave for 3 minutes.
- Let sit until cooled.
- Squeeze out excess water with a paper towel, transfer to a resealable plastic bag, weigh, then add the remaining ingredients.
- Massage the bag until the dough reaches a firmness slightly softer than your ear lobe.
- The dough should be able to slide out of the bag easily.
- Transfer to work surface, dust if dough is soft, divide into 5 or 6 pieces, then roll out to desired shapes.
- Don't roll them too thinly.
- Coat frying pan in oil (not listed) and fry each side for 2 to 3 minutes.
- For those concerned about calorie intake, use a non-stick pan without oil.
